• 我的工程使用了串口中断,但偶尔会造成代码卡死,通过验证,发现是触发了溢出中断,如何解决?

  • 创建于2022-10-24

    串口,cpu,寄存器,验证 串口,cpu,寄存器,验证 串口,cpu,寄存器,验证 串口,cpu,寄存器,验证

1个回答

  • 用户_4316 (0)
    如果代码中使能了接收中断,在通讯过程中如出现溢出错误,会触发溢出错误中断,如果不对标志位进行清除,会导致串口中断被一直触发,抢占cpu 资源,导致代码卡死;
    解决办法是需要在串口中断中判断该溢出标志,如存在则清除标志位,并读一次数据寄存器
    创建于2022-10-24
  • +1 赞 0
  • 收藏

相关推荐

使用串口中断,偶尔会造成代码卡死,发现是触发了溢出中断,如何解决?

2024-05-25 -  技术问答 如果代码中使能了接收中断,在通讯过程中如出现溢出错误,会触发溢出错误中断,如果不对标志位进行清除,会导致串口中断被一直触发,抢占 CPU 资源,导致代码卡死;解决办法是需要在串口中断中判断该溢出标志,如存在则清除标志位,并读一次数据寄存器。

代理服务

公司有项目使用了雅特力的AT32F421,出现了ISP串口下载卡死问题,如何解决?

2021-03-01 -  技术问答 使用ISP 串口下载时,偶尔会卡死,卡死之后电脑无法释放串口。 建议处理方式: 1、电源是否不稳定; 2、更换质量更好的USB 转串口工具,如CH340 芯片等。

代理服务

GR5515IGND的uart 中断是怎么清除的,为什么我的串口没发数据,一直进入中断回调函数? 请问串口中断是如何清除的? 进一步测试:发现调用这个接口后bsp_log_init(里头会执行uart0初始化),会出现不停中断的情况,请问这个接口有什么特别的吗?我想用这个做log输出口,同时作为输入口,输入指令。

2023-05-26 -  技术问答 您好, 1、底层寄存器操作目前是封装在lib中的,一般应用不需要关注,在完成发送后会自动清除标志; 2、SDK中默认使用uart0作为log输出端口,支持输入,可以在应用层对接收数据进行处理; 3、调试时可以监视线上状态,是否有数据一直在发送引起进入中断回调; 另外,对于uart的使用,你可以参考示例工程,目录:projects\peripheral_app\uart

我用STM32H743驱动的MLX90640,我发现90640的初始化还有读取温度值的函数直接把我的串口中断给关了,用了这些函数直接不进中断,只要用了MLX90640的驱动函数,直接不进串口中断,重新初始化串口就能就去,有知道怎么回事的吗?谢谢了,

2020-06-15 -  技术问答 可能是因为mlx90640的函数涉及到700多个点的浮点数计算,太占MCU资源了,导致中断发过来后长时间没有处理中断超时了,还有一种可能是你代码里面是否有添加串口打印数据?是否有冲突,STM32H743属于高端MCU了,是否有待RTOS?可否单独开一条线程处理?

串口没有使能溢出中断,但相应的标志位会置位

2024-05-25 -  技术问答 在使能了接收中断之后,溢出中断就自动使能了。所以在串口中断函数里面需要注意溢出中断的处理(溢出中断清除步骤:先读取 STS 寄存器,再读取 DAT 寄存器)

代理服务

G-NiceRF无线模块选型表

选型表  -  G-NiceRF G-NiceRF提供LoRa/2.4G/ASK/UHF/VHF/卫星定位/蓝牙/UWB/对讲机/计步/降噪/跌倒检测等全品类无线模块选型。覆盖433/470/868/915MHz及2.4 GHz、6.5 GHz多频段,功率0.001-5 W,灵敏度-166~-94 dBm;尺寸最小8×9 mm,最大90×104 mm,电压1.8-8.5 V,接收电流1.5-165 mA,均符合ROHS/CE/FCC认证。可选TTL/232/485接口、TCXO温补晶振、MINI封装,适用于物联网、对讲、定位、音频、可穿戴等场景。

产品型号
品类
尺寸(mm)
等级认证标准
工作频率(MHz)
输出功率(mW、W)
LORA1276-C1-915MHZ
LORA无线模块
16mmx16mm
ROHS,IC,ID,FCC
915MHz
100mW
立即选型
代理服务

【经验】解析航顺芯片老版本MCU HK32F103串口USART通讯时偶尔出现数据错误的原因及解决方法

2022-03-01 -  设计经验 有部分客户在使用航顺芯片HK32F103系列芯片的串口通讯时,偶尔出现数据错误,本文主要解析其数据错误的原因及解决方法。

代理服务

ZETTA 集成 SPI NOR 芯片选型表

选型表  -  ZETTA 澜智集成提供业界标准的25 系列SPI串口NOR Flash产品,小型化封装、多容量选择,兼容的指令集,宽电压和高可靠性全面覆盖消费,通讯、工业和个人电脑等应用领域。超低功耗;BP位保护、OTP保护、独立block区域保护确保代码安全;BP位保护、OTP保护、独立block区域保护确保代码安全;2Mb-32Mb 1.65~3.6V 宽电压,64Mb-512Mb 2.7~3.6V;DFN 0.7x1.0x0.45mm,1.5x1.5x0.45mm,2x3x0.45mm等小尺寸封装;

产品型号
品类
SPI串口NOR Flash
电压
温度
封装
ZD25WD20CJIGR
SPI串口NOR Flash芯片
2Mb
1.65~3.6V
-40°C~85°C
DFN6 1.0x0.7x0.45mm
立即选型
代理服务

沃进科技无线模块选型表

选型表  -  沃进科技 提供沃进科技选型,接口类型:SPI,UART,UART/GPIO,工作频率:2.4GHz- 5.8GHz,240MHz- 915MHz,GPS L1\BD2 B1,发射功率:7dBm- 30dBm,通信距离:200m-5000m,空中速率: 0.018kbps- 500Kbps,封装形式:SMD、贴片,不同的产品尺寸。

产品型号
品类
接口类型
工作频率(MHz/GHz)
发射功率(dBm)
通信距离(m)
空中速率(Kbps/Mbps)
封装形式
产品尺寸(mm)
VG35S2S240X0M1
双向无线收发模块
SPI
2.4GHz
20dBm
500m
250Kbps/1Mbps/2Mbps
SMD
16.0mmx24.0mm
立即选型
代理服务

扬州国芯触屏IC选型表

选型表  -  扬州国芯 扬州国芯提供了触屏IC产品,可用在电网,通讯,汽车电子,工业设备,消费电子,互联网,智能家居等领域,工作电压范围在3~15V,静态电流0.01uA~80uA,输入电容5~15pF,工作温度-20~85℃,DIP14/DIP16/SOP14/SOP16封装形式。

产品型号
品类
工作电压(V)
静态电流
输入电容
低导通电阻
工作温度(℃)
封装形式
CD4001_SOP14
四路2输入或非门集成电路
3~15V
0.01uA
5pF
-
-20~85℃
SOP14
立即选型
代理服务

九州风神铲齿散热器&CPU散热器选型表

选型表  -  九州风神 九州风神提供多样化的CPU散热器和铲齿散热器选型,适配Intel LGA 115X和AMD AM4平台。产品涵盖主动顶吹和侧吹,以及被动散热方式。尺寸从93.5mm到492mm不等,重量269g至31689g,TDP支持45W至100W。风扇规格包括8015、8025、9225等,转速2200rpm至2800rpm。材质主要为铝挤和铝齿,适用于多种应用场景,包括智能家居、小家电、灯控等。保质期均为1年。

产品型号
品类
适配平台
尺寸-长(mm)
尺寸-宽(mm)
尺寸-高(mm)
形态(主/被动)
制程及材质
净重(g)
保质期(年)
TDP(W)
装孔孔位(mm)
风扇规格
C-HTPC-11
CPU散热器
Intel LGA 115X
93.5
94
37.5
主动, 顶吹
铝挤
269
1
45
75*75
8015, 2600rpm
立即选型
代理服务

沁恒USB转单串口芯片选型表

选型表  -  沁恒 沁恒USB转单串口芯片选型表提供USB高速/全速转串口系列芯片,可实现USB转1/2/4/8路串口,支持串口I/O独立供电,支持VCP/HID/CDC/AOA转串口,VCP串口支持硬件流控和高波特率大数据连续传输,部分型号支持VID/PID/String等内容配置,支持Windows/Linux/Android/macOS等操作系统。

产品型号
品类
串口数
USB
驱动类型
峰值最高波特率(Mbps)
流控连续波特率(Mbps)
硬件流控
自动控制RS485
USB配置
IO电压(V)
MUC电压(V)
省电双供电&IO防倒灌
MODEM信号(兼GPIO和其他接口)
内置时钟
温度范围(℃)
封装
内核
CH343P
USB转单串口芯片
1
全速
VCP/CDC
6Mbps
6Mbps
内置
5V/3.3V/2.5V/1.8V
5V/3.3V/2.5V/1.8V
RTS/CTS/DTR/DSR/DCD/RI
-40~+85℃
QFN16
第3代
立即选型
代理服务

【产品】支持半双工收发自动切换的双串口芯片CH432,通讯波特率最高达4Mbps

2022-08-14 -  产品 沁恒推出的CH432是双UART芯片(双串口芯片),包含两个兼容16C550的异步串口,支持半双工收发自动切换和IrDA红外编解码,支持最高4Mbps的通讯波特率,可以用于单片机/嵌入式系统的RS23串口扩展、带自动硬件速率控制的高速串口、RS485通讯、IrDA通讯等。

代理服务

请问BW16模组可以通过232串口通讯么

2024-09-30 -  技术问答 可以

代理服务

骏晔科技模块选型表

选型表  -  骏晔科技 骏晔科技提供用于无线数据采集,无线游戏控制,数据监控传输,环境监控,工业控制,医疗健康,消费电子,智能家居,智能农业,智慧能源,IoT终端,航空建模等领域的2.4G ISM频段,FSK双向收发模块,ASK模块,UART无线串口模块,LoRa模块,蓝牙BLE 5.0/5.1模块。

产品型号
品类
频率[MHz]
调制方式
发射功率[dBm]
接收灵敏度[dBm]
传输距离[m]
工作电压[V]
工作电流
待机电流[μA]
尺寸[mm]
DL-RX06C-LO6测试板
DEMO测试板
433MHz
ASK
/
-112dBm
300m
3.0V~5.5V
6mA
<1μA
/
立即选型
代理服务
展开更多

平台合作

电子商城

查看更多

品牌:兴威帆

品类:实时时钟IC

代理店

价格:¥5.8500

现货:585,235

品牌:兴威帆

品类:实时时钟IC

代理店

价格:¥8.0100

现货:498,458

品牌:兴威帆

品类:实时时钟IC

代理店

价格:¥2.5000

现货:459,602

品牌:兴威帆

品类:实时时钟IC

代理店

价格:¥1.8000

现货:396,500

品牌:华轩阳电子

品类:移位寄存器

代理店

价格:¥0.2529

现货:300,000

品牌:华轩阳电子

品类:寄存器

代理店

价格:¥0.2387

现货:300,000

品牌:优恩半导体

品类:RS485串口芯片

代理店

价格:¥1.8572

现货:257,100

品牌:兴威帆

品类:实时时钟IC

代理店

价格:¥2.5000

现货:226,654

品牌:优恩半导体

品类:RS485串口芯片

代理店

现货:194,152

品牌:兴威帆

品类:时钟芯片

代理店

价格:¥3.5000

现货:116,041

品牌:兴威帆

品类:实时时钟IC

代理店

价格:

现货:

品牌:兴威帆

品类:实时时钟IC

代理店

价格:

现货:

品牌:兴威帆

品类:实时时钟IC

代理店

价格:

现货:

品牌:兴威帆

品类:实时时钟IC

代理店

价格:

现货:

品牌:华轩阳电子

品类:移位寄存器

代理店

价格:

现货:

品牌:华轩阳电子

品类:寄存器

代理店

价格:

现货:

品牌:优恩半导体

品类:RS485串口芯片

代理店

价格:

现货:

品牌:兴威帆

品类:实时时钟IC

代理店

价格:

现货:

品牌:优恩半导体

品类:RS485串口芯片

代理店

现货:

品牌:兴威帆

品类:时钟芯片

代理店

价格:

现货:

服务市场

查看更多

高性能CPU散热器定制

铭旺电子(Ming wang Electronics)以铲齿铝鳍、回流焊铜底、PWM风扇一体化工艺,为AI服务器/工作站定制CPU散热器,ΔT≤8 ℃@350 W,助力释放芯片极限算力。

提交需求>

高热流密度液冷板定制

定制液冷板尺寸5mm*5mm~3m*1.8m,厚度2mm-100mm,单相液冷板散热能力最高300W/cm²。

最小起订量:1片 提交需求>

现货市场

查看更多

品牌:Microchip

品类:MCU

价格:¥9.0000

现货:64,841

品牌:汇顶科技

品类:蓝牙系统级芯片

价格:¥4.5000

现货:53,089

品牌:雅特力

品类:微控制器

价格:¥2.5900

现货:46,103

品牌:Maxim

品类:稳压器

价格:¥20.0000

现货:16,894

品牌:Maxim

品类:稳压器

价格:¥8.0000

现货:10,751

品牌:灵星芯微

品类:移位寄存器

价格:¥0.6486

现货:10,000

品牌:灵星芯微

品类:移位寄存器

价格:¥0.3802

现货:10,000

品牌:灵星芯微

品类:移位寄存器

价格:¥1.2023

现货:10,000

品牌:灵星芯微

品类:移位寄存器

价格:¥0.2969

现货:10,000

品牌:灵星芯微

品类:移位寄存器

价格:¥0.1699

现货:10,000

品牌:Microchip

品类:MCU

价格:

现货:

品牌:汇顶科技

品类:蓝牙系统级芯片

价格:

现货:

品牌:雅特力

品类:微控制器

价格:

现货:

品牌:Maxim

品类:稳压器

价格:

现货:

品牌:Maxim

品类:稳压器

价格:

现货:

品牌:灵星芯微

品类:移位寄存器

价格:

现货:

品牌:灵星芯微

品类:移位寄存器

价格:

现货:

品牌:灵星芯微

品类:移位寄存器

价格:

现货:

品牌:灵星芯微

品类:移位寄存器

价格:

现货:

品牌:灵星芯微

品类:移位寄存器

价格:

现货:

查看更多

授权代理品牌:接插件及结构件

查看更多

授权代理品牌:部件、组件及配件

查看更多

授权代理品牌:电源及模块

查看更多

授权代理品牌:电子材料

查看更多

授权代理品牌:仪器仪表及测试配组件

查看更多

授权代理品牌:电工工具及材料

查看更多

授权代理品牌:机械电子元件

查看更多

授权代理品牌:加工与定制

世强和原厂的技术专家将在一个工作日内解答,帮助您快速完成研发及采购。
我要提问

954668/400-830-1766(工作日 9:00-18:00)

service@sekorm.com

平台客服
扫码关注
关注世强硬创
解锁服务进度实时跟踪和专属客服特权
服务热线

联系我们

954668/400-830-1766(工作日 9:00-18:00)

service@sekorm.com

投诉与建议

E-mail:claim@sekorm.com

商务合作

E-mail:contact@sekorm.com

收藏
收藏当前页面